Frontend or backend, complex web portal or online shop, micro frontend or mini application, CMS or IoT, iOS or Android: As a Software Developer, together with your team, you’re involved in advancing exciting web and digital projects. From local SMEs to global corporations, from manufacturers of smoke alarms to retail giants and football clubs: With your ideas and skills, you create digital experiences that inspire companies and their customers alike and drive companies forward long-term.
As a Software Developer, the abundance of projects guarantees one thing above all else; diversity and variety in everyday work, continuous professional development and a broad technology stack. The actual projects you are assigned and main focus of your job will be determined by your knowledge as well as the interests you want to develop further.
Frontend, backend and mobile development jobs are waiting for you. In our job portal, you’ll find Software Developer roles in which you can leave your mark on the digital world.
You develop a variety of web portals, user interfaces and applications for our clients. You analyse technical and operational requirements for feasibility and develop clearly designed and sustainable code with your colleagues. To ensure their requirements are implemented in the best way, you liaise closely with our clients and also advise them.
As a Frontend Developer, you turn design concepts into reality. You develop modern, interactive and responsive web portal and micro frontends as well as web applications. You work closely with our UX and UI team, suggest optimisations, and assess technical feasibility. Depending on your professional experience and the project, you assume either purely development or sometimes technical leadership roles within the project.
Visit our references page to get an initial idea of the kind of projects in which your frontend expertise and ideas are needed.
Your tech stack: JavaScript, HTML 5, CSS 3, React, Angular, Vue.js, Node.js, Sass, LESS, Webpack.
As an iOS or Android Developer, you develop mobile solutions, such as progressive web apps, cross-platform solutions or native apps that inspire users and simplify processes at the point of sale or as an IoT/mobile commerce application. You work closely with graphics and UX and have a flair for technology, aesthetics and usability. You work in multi-site project teams and are a member of the in-house Mobile Chapter to develop the department further at diva-e.
Visit our references page to get an initial idea of the kind of projects in which your expertise and ideas as a Mobile Developer are needed.
Your tech stack: SWIFT, Objective-C, Java, Kotlin, Xcode, Android Studio, AppCode.
As a Backend Developer, you lay the foundations for the functionality of digital solutions. Depending on the project, you and your team develop either the entire solution or individual applications that you connect to the overall system via various interfaces. No two projects are alike: You use a variety of technologies, discover new solutions and work together with the most diverse specialist areas in both our clients’ and our own company. Depending on your professional experience and the project, you assume either purely development or sometimes technical leadership roles within the project.
We use the latest technologies for the implementation of our projects, mostly the programming language Java and Kotlin is used.
Visit our references page to get an initial idea of the kind of projects in which your backend expertise and ideas are needed.
Your tech stack:
Java, Kotlin, Groovy or PHP
Spring Framework
Eclipse or Intellij
Maven, Gradle, GitLab or Jenkins
Gladly also experience in Adobe AEM, SAP Commerce or Bloomreach Experience Manager
As a PHP developer at diva-e, you will design innovative, sustainable e-commerce solutions for B2B and B2C in the backend. We mainly build our platforms for well-known companies from various industries with Spryker and Magento - feel free to take a look at our references to get a first impression.
Implement your ideas together with changing project teams from areas like strategy consulting, UX/UI, performance marketing, operations and system administration.
You can find more information about possible tasks and personal experience reports on our PHP development page. There, our experts at diva-e will introduce you to their areas of expertise in more detail.
As an AEM Developer at diva-e, you will work with a diverse team from development and UX/UI to implement sophisticated solutions for AEM - both in the backend and frontend.
Together with your colleagues, you will develop and program components of lasting value. In backend development for AEM, we focus on Java technologies. In frontend development we use web components with HTML5, CSS3 and TypeScript. In addition, we also develop applications with React, Angular or Vue.js.
In our references you can get a first impression of possible projects, in which your know-how and your ideas around AEM are in demand.
In our diverse teams, you work as a Software Developer with your colleagues on contrasting client projects. Generally, our projects run for a few months to several years. You always work on a client project with diva-e colleagues with different roles, experience levels and possibly locations. We work agile and closely together in a team. Depending on the project, team sizes range between 3 and 20 diva-e employees.
During projects, you either work remotely or at the client’s premises, sometimes for several days. Of course, we try to keep travel to a minimum and to accommodate your personal circumstances. But unfortunately, in our industry, travel can’t always be avoided. The need to travel may be slightly higher at the start of the project, but then decline over time. What’s more, it’s important to us that you can work when and where you are most productive. Therefore, we also offer attractive mobile working options.
Our focus is clearly on the employee. Flat hierarchies and treating each other as equals ensures open and transparent communication at all levels. This creates an excellent workplace atmosphere in which teamwork is of the upmost importance. You work with subject matter experts in their respective field so you always have a suitable ‘sparring partner’ at your side or a contact to discuss new ideas. It’s important to us that you feel comfortable with the tools of your trade so you decide the software and hardware you use through our order catalogue.
You’re a team player and really flourish when given the space to perform. You don’t just rely on your current knowledge and aren’t afraid to try new things. You keep your eyes and ears open, question existing processes critically and don’t shy away from addressing and implementing potential optimisations. You like to share your knowledge with your colleagues and you bring fresh ideas to the team and the project.
It’s important for us that you’re passionate about your job and fit into the team. No matter if you’ve changed career or are self-taught, you have exactly the same opportunities with us as someone with an IT apprenticeship or computer science background. Above all, your personality is important to us, and we'll take care of the technical stuff!
As you can see, we have so much to offer you. Do you have any further questions? Then we look forward to your message! Or you can apply for the right position straight away!